The Toi o te Ora - AUT Wellbeing Research Network is seeking a well-organised and proactive Network Research Coordinator to support the smooth delivery and growth of collaborative research initiatives. This is a pivotal coordination role that blends operational planning, project management, and research support helping to strengthen AUT's research performance in wellbeing, health, and social impact.
A core priority of the Network is to drive the growth of externally funded research by actively pursuing competitive funding opportunities, from government agencies, philanthropic organisations, industry partners, and international funding bodies, to enable large-scale, transformative projects. The position will enhance the Network's capacity to pursue and secure these competitive funding opportunities and maintain continuity of resources to support ongoing and future research programmes.
About the Role
This operational support role contributes to the success of a dynamic research network with key responsibilities to:
Provide coordination and administrative support for research projects, events, and stakeholder engagement.
Assist with the preparation and submission of research proposals and related documentation.
Support post-award administration, including tracking deliverables and maintaining reporting systems.
Manage project budgets, assisting with financial monitoring, and planning.
Contribute to the identification and pursuit of new collaboration and funding opportunities.
Support the Network's communications, knowledge-sharing, and internal systems.
Uphold te Tiriti o Waitangi principles across all aspects of engagement and research support.
Maintain a comprehensive understanding of the Network's activities, systems, and relationships, especially those tied to securing and managing external funding.
The Network Coordinator will also be expected to step up and support the Network Research Manager role to maintain continuity during senior staff absences.
About You
You are a highly organised and adaptable research professional with a strong eye for detail and a collaborative approach. You bring:
Proven experience supporting high-level, wellbeing related research projects, ideally within a university or public sector environment.
An extensive understanding of research processes, systems, and documentation requirements.
Financial literacy and experience, having familiarity of financial policy and processes, understanding budget reports, monitoring and revising budget expenditure and financial compliance.
Excellent interpersonal and communication skills, with confidence managing multiple relationships and stakeholder needs.
The ability to work independently, and flexibly as needed to meet critical deadlines and ensure priority tasks are completed.
A commitment to culturally responsive practice and embedding te Tiriti o Waitangi.
